Upskilling Young Talents through Summer Internships and Trainee Programmes

HKSAR Government’s Scheme on Corporate Summer Internship on the Mainland and Overseas 2023
Participating in the HKSAR Government’s Scheme on Corporate Summer Internship on the Mainland for the third time, Henderson Land recruited 11 post-secondary students for an eight-week internship in 2023, during which they joined the Leasing Department of the Group’s Beijing, Shanghai and Guangzhou offices. By providing summer internship placements in mainland China to the city’s youth, we hope to broaden participants’ horizons and help them establish personal networks, paving the way for their future personal and professional development.

Upon returning to Hong Kong, the interns took part in a sharing session organised by the Group, in which they visited the control room and rooftop of Two International Finance Centre, in addition to going on a guided tour of the show suite of The Henderson, the Group’s flagship development in Central, to learn about its architectural design and innovations.

Dr Lee Ka Shing, Martin, Chairman of the Group, met up with the interns to hear about their experiences over the summer. Offering them words of encouragement, Dr Lee said: “I hope all of you will continue this meaningful exchange with the youth and professionals from mainland China and beyond in the future, fostering mutual learning, sparking each other’s imagination and striving to develop into a new generation with a global vision, great ambition and innovative thinking”.

Ms Akemi Wong Hiu-yau
Interned in Guangzhou
“As someone with no prior exposure to the real estate sector, I was heartened by the opportunity to explore the shopping mall business from an operational perspective. This experience has sparked my interest in the industry, and I would be open to working in the Greater Bay Area in the future.”

Mr Anthony Wong Chun-hin
Interned in Shanghai
“Like the projects in Hong Kong, those in mainland China abound in green spaces. And through the insightful talks arranged by the Group, it is clear to me that sustainability has emerged as a prevailing trend in property development.”

Ms Angel Siu Ki-ki
Interned in Beijing
“This internship was a precious opportunity for me to better understand myself, plan for my future career and get acquainted with the workplace culture in mainland China.”
